29 MPG combined is the headline for the 2015 Mitsubishi Lancer 2.0L, and while it won’t set any records, it’s perfectly acceptable for what the Lancer is: an affordable, reliable, and relatively sporty compact sedan. This isn’t a hybrid or a bare-bones economy car. The Lancer appeals to buyers seeking a practical daily driver with a touch of fun, prioritizing affordability and distinctive styling over outright fuel efficiency.
City and highway performance
The EPA estimates for the 2015 Lancer 2.0L with the automatic transmission are 26 MPG in the city and 33 MPG on the highway. The city figure reflects the stop-and-go nature of urban driving, where frequent acceleration and deceleration affect fuel consumption. The 33 MPG highway estimate is more impressive. Here, the Lancer’s efficient engine and well-tuned automatic transmission (AV-S6) can shine, allowing for relaxed cruising and respectable gas mileage on longer trips.
Annual fuel cost
The EPA calculates the annual fuel cost for the 2015 Mitsubishi Lancer 2.0L at $1,500. This figure is based on driving 15,000 miles per year and using national average fuel prices. Of course, this is just an estimate. Your actual fuel costs will vary depending on your driving habits, the type of roads you drive on, and the price of gasoline in your area. But $1,500 provides a useful benchmark for comparing the Lancer’s fuel costs against other vehicles in its class. Real-world expectations
While the EPA estimates provide a standardized benchmark, real-world fuel economy can differ. Lancer owners often report mileage within a reasonable range of the EPA figures, but aggressive driving styles, frequent short trips, and hilly terrain can all lower fuel economy. Remember that the Lancer’s performance-oriented image can tempt drivers to push the car harder, which will negatively affect MPG. How it compares
Compared to its competitors, the 2015 Mitsubishi Lancer 2.0L lands in the middle of the pack. The Honda Civic, particularly the HF trim, can achieve upwards of 41 MPG on the highway, making it a noticeably more fuel-efficient choice. The Toyota Corolla LE Eco, with its emphasis on fuel economy, boasts around 42 MPG highway as well. On the other hand, some sportier rivals, like the Mazda3 2.5L, prioritize driving enjoyment over fuel efficiency, and deliver slightly lower MPG figures, for example, 28 MPG combined. This comparison highlights the Lancer’s position as a balanced option: more engaging to drive than the most economical choices, but not as thirsty as some of the performance-focused alternatives. Tips to maximize efficiency
Adopt a smooth and consistent driving style. Avoid sudden acceleration and hard braking, as these actions consume significantly more fuel. Anticipate traffic flow and plan your maneuvers accordingly. A gentler driving style can noticeably improve your MPG, especially in city driving.
Ensure your tires are properly inflated. Underinflated tires increase rolling resistance, which reduces fuel efficiency. Check your tire pressure regularly and inflate them to the recommended level, which can be found on a sticker inside the driver’s side doorjamb or in your owner’s manual. This is an easy way to maintain optimal fuel economy.
Minimize idling time. If you’re stopped for more than a minute, turn off the engine. Modern engines are designed to restart quickly and efficiently, so prolonged idling is simply wasting fuel. In colder climates especially, drivers often let their cars idle long beyond what is necessary.
Keep up with routine maintenance. Regular oil changes, air filter replacements, and spark plug maintenance are important for maintaining optimal engine performance and fuel efficiency. A poorly maintained engine will work harder and consume more fuel.
Consider the weight you’re carrying. Remove unnecessary items from your car’s trunk and backseat. Excess weight increases fuel consumption. Carrying around sports equipment or other items which are not needed will lead to noticeably lower fuel economy.
